Michael Myers Was Already Famous When Mike Myers Became Famous

The first Halloween movie came out in 1978, making Michael Myers a household name. On the other hand, Mike Myers did not really become famous until the 1990s. Sure, he’d had some minor roles in some movies and shows in Canada, but he was not a mainstream success by any means. He didn’t hit it big until 1989; even then, he wasn’t a household name. He landed a job on a little television show called Saturday Night Live. That show took up six years of his life – he did not leave until 1995. It’s where Mike Myers made a name for himself (rather than his own name already being used by a fake serial killer).

From Wayne’s World to Austin Powers

By 1997, Mike Myers had changed the game with yet another memorable role. He took on the role of Austin Powers, International Man of Mystery. It was another role that allowed the hilarious comedian to play a character who is too stupid for his own good, as well as various other characters in the movie. He wasn’t just Austin Powers. He was also Austin Power’s biggest nemesis, Dr. Evil. He changed the game yet again with various movies in this franchise.

How Did Mike Myers’ Net Worth Grow?

We’ll start with his biggest and first major franchise roles. When Mike Myers starred in Wayne’s World, he earned $1 million for the first movie and $3.5 million for the second. When Mike Myers began acting as Austin Powers, he was earning $3.5 million per movie. By the time the studio signed him on to the second movie, they were paying him $7 million. When the contract rolled in for the third Austin Powers movie, the studio paid Mike Myers a staggering $25 million.

His Shrek paychecks never reached the same scale as his final Austin Powers paycheck. However, he also didn’t have to sit in hair and make-up or memorize his lines. He lent his voice to the character, which is slightly less taxing than taking on the entirety of a role. For the first Shrek movie, he earned $3 million. The second movie paid him $10 million. He earned $15 million for the third Shrek, and he earned the same $15 million for the fourth Shrek.
